My headlights are different colors?!?!?

My car was recently repaired due to a minor accident. The driver's side headlight was replaced. I just noticed tonight that they appear to be different colors. The new one has a yellowish tint while the passenger side one has the normal blueish xenon tint. The housing of the two looks exactly the same. Is it even possible to put the wrong kind of bulb in the headlight? Would different "batches" of headlights be slightly different to others?

Xenon bulbs are available in different "colors" and your shop ordered the wrong one. The color output is denoted by the degrees Kelvin of the light. Could be that you got a 3800K instead of a 4300K or somesuch.

It is likely that they used an OEM MINI headlight. As the bulbs age, the color exhibits a subtle shift to blue. If you put a fresh bulb in the other headlight, they'll match.

I had a headlight washer die under warranty. The dealership replaced the entire headlight, and I noticed the same difference in colors. As time wears on, they'll get closer in color.
